Is Nivea sunscreen physical or chemical?

Nivea Sunscreen Ingredients:

Nivea Sunscreen has great long and short UVA and UVB protection. It is a Hybrid Sunscreen with Titanium Dioxide(physical); old-school filters Octocrylene & Oxybenzone and new generation chemical UV filter Bemotrizinol.

Is SPF 50 sunscreen good enough?

Sunburn protection is only marginally better.

Properly applied SPF 50 sunscreen blocks 98 percent of UVB rays; SPF 100 blocks 99 percent. When used correctly, sunscreen with SPF values between 30 and 50 offers adequate sunburn protection, even for people most sensitive to sunburn.

What is the difference between zinc and mineral sunscreen?

The key difference between mineral and chemical sunscreens is that mineral/physical sunscreens sit on top of the skin and block rays at the surface using ingredients like zinc oxide and titanium dioxide, while chemical sunscreens absorb rays like a sponge using ingredients like oxybenzone, avobenzone, octisalate, ...

What is the difference between mineral and normal sunscreen?

The key difference between these types of sunscreens lies in how they block rays. Physical (mineral) sunscreens sit on the surface of your skin and act as a shield, while chemical sunscreens sink into your skin and act more like a sponge.

Is SPF 30 or 50 everyday better?

A sunscreen with SPF 30 will protect you from around 96.7% of UVB rays, whereas an SPF of 50 means protection from about 98% of UVB rays. Anything beyond SPF 50 makes very little difference in terms of risk of sun damage, and no sunscreens offer 100% protection from UVB rays.

What is the 2 finger rule for sunscreen?

Sunscreen can be applied to each of these areas at a dose of 2 mg/cm2 if two strips of sunscreen are squeezed out on to both the index and middle fingers from the palmar crease to the fingertips.

Which Nivea sunscreen fail?

⚠ Kids sun cream test fail | Nivea's Kids Protect & Care SPF50+ failed our SPF test, falling far short of the SPF50 claim on the bottle. A further test on a second sample found the measured SPF was even lower. In response, Beiersdorf, maker of Nivea, told us: 'The safety of our products is of utmost importance.

Which NIVEA sunscreen has been recalled?

Important Information. Following product testing, NIVEA Sun (owned by Beiersdorf) recalled in April 2022 two batches that had been identified as having levels of benzene above the 2 part per million (ppm) permissible levels set of the Australian Therapeutic Goods Administration (TGA).
